A combination of the method of moments and the geometrical theory of diffraction (g.t.d.) is used to predict the radiation properties of 90° semiangle conical horns possessing a number of annular slots in the flange. Computed and measured results show good agreement, and a set of theoretical curves is given for application of the horn as a feed.
